At the Coast Clinic I am always on the look out for the most effective treatments to help to defy the visible effects of ageing. So you can imagine my surprise when I came accross the latest slimy trend in Japan.
Earlier this month it was reported that people there are forking out £165 for a facial treatment where live snails are applied to the skin.
Medical experts claim the sticky gel snails produce contains antioxidants that help the skin retain moisture, and remove dead cells. Live snails slither across the face, delivering antioxidants to the skin. The garden variety are not recommended due to contaminants. This facial is available only in Japan. So is it a farce or a fact? Chilean snail farmers noticed they had very smooth hands, and this sparked a skincare revolution. A study released this year showed that daily application of products containing snail slime improved fine lines. A 2007 clinical trial using snail gel on rats showed it was excellent for wound-healing.: Will it work? Well the slimy mucus will have a moisturising effect, if you could bear the snails crawling on your face for one hour!!
So what might work and is less freaky? Well there is a new facial treatment know as the ‘ Notox’. This alternative to botox has all of the wrinkle busting effects of Botox but without the nasty injections and toxins. Its a three step process.
Step 1: Microdermabrasion and LED Therapy
The treatment offers a revolutionary new orbital microdermabrasion system. It literally revolves. The dead skin is taken off by a gently abrasive rotating rubber tip which gently and vibrates and exfoliates your skin.
Compared with other types of micro-dermabrasion which use crystals that are sand-blasted across your skin, the Notox is not harsh and uncomfortable.
Red blue and yellow LED light therapy are also used. Red and yellow light are very healing and helps to regenerate the collagen and elastin production in the skin, and the blue light kills off bacteria.
Step 2: Oxygen Infusion
After 10-15 minutes, of micro-dermabrasion an have an oxygen infusion of serum is applied using pressurised oxygen to gently push the serum deep into the skin. There is a the Skin Brightening serum which gives you an even skin-tone and makes your skin look really radiant or an anti-ageing Rejuvenation serum which contain neuro-peptides which inhibit muscle contractions thus reducing the creation of lines and wrinkles.
And it really works, and it feels like your face muscles are immediately pulled tighter after the treatment.
Step 3: Hydro Mask and Spot Treatment
Finally is the Hydro-Mask which helps to cool and relaxing. It has serum underneath it so it really hydrates your skin on contact. A massage tip then goes over the mask to get the products to penetrate deep into your skin. At the same time I the LED light therapy can be used and is really good for treating spots, acne, and acne scarring.
The Notox facial costs between £50 and £100 depending on which serum you choose. However it is only available within specialist skin and rejuvenation clinics as the treatment can only be undertaken by a specialist skin technician.
